IDP

Abbreviation · Security & Infosec

Definitions

  1. Short for identity provider, the service that authenticates users and issues assertions or tokens to relying applications in federated login systems. An IdP is central to SSO because it becomes the source of truth for authentication events and identity claims.

    In plain English: The service that signs users in and tells other apps they are authenticated.

    Example: "The outage affected dozens of apps because the shared IdP could not issue login assertions."
